How to cook steak for Super Bowl spread

DO: Thaw steak. Dry off the steak. Salt the steak. Wait hours or overnight in the refrigerator. 

DOESN'T MATTER: if you sear, fry, grill, sou vid, smoke, bake, air-fry, 

DON'T: start a grease fire on the grill. 

DO: Have a meat thermometer and use it. 

DON'T: Cook past 125 degrees F internal temperature. 

DO: Place on a board with a combination of olive oil, butter, pepper, garlic, green onion and fresh or dried herb. Cover with aluminum foil and a cloth to "rest" or let the temperatures even out. Allow 10 minutes. 

DO: Cut steak into strips on the board, let the seasoning oil cover the pieces. 

DO: Serve on the Superbowl spread. Allow a cover for the steak to keep warm, but if they are all snatched up it doesn't really matter.
